      Maybe DNS is misconfigured. If I remember correctly you need to have static routes to make sure that requests to your ISPs DNS server goes out correctly - policy based routing does NOT work for requests from the firewall itself.

          Quickguide:
          At system>general, use one DNS from WAN, one from WAN2. Then add a static route at system>static routes to <dns of="" wan2="">/32 to your wan2 interface with gateway <wan2 gateway="">. That should fix it.</wan2></dns>

                  In general yes. Unless the 2 lines with the dns server fail simultaneously you would be ok. I think you can add a 3rd, 4th, … DNS through hidden config.xml settings too (download your config.xml and duplicate a dns setting and add another dns server there).

                          system>static routes:
                          add a route like "Interface OPT-WAN, subnet <dns-server at="" opt-wan="">/32, gateway <opt-wan-gateway>Then male sure you use this DNS at system>general as one of your dns servers (one from WAN and one from OPT-WAN).</opt-wan-gateway></dns-server>
